A garage bike storage guide has to account for more than the number of bicycles. A light road bike, a long trail bike, a child’s bike, and a 65-pound electric bike ask different things of the rack and the rider. Tires, fenders, frame shape, handlebar width, brake cables, and lifting ability all affect fit. Start by measuring each bike and watching how it enters the garage. Then choose floor, vertical, pivoting, horizontal, or ceiling storage for that exact routine.
Quick answer
Use floor stands for heavy bikes, children’s bikes, and anything ridden daily by someone who cannot lift it comfortably. Vertical wheel racks save wall width and work well for several bikes when heights are staggered. Pivoting vertical racks reduce aisle projection after loading. Horizontal frame cradles suit one or two display-worthy bikes and avoid wheel hooks, but they consume a long wall. Verify bike weight, tire width, wheel diameter, fenders, frame contact, mounting structure, and the clear loading lane before buying.

Measure every bicycle in its normal setup
Record overall length, handlebar width, total weight, wheel diameter, inflated tire width, and the highest point. Note fenders, front baskets, child seats, mirrors, kickstands, and cables. A printed tire size is a starting point; measure the real inflated width when the rack manufacturer tells you to.
Photograph the frame from the side. Horizontal cradles may struggle with low step-through tubes, compact full-suspension shapes, or cables routed where the cradle touches. Wheel racks need clearance around rims, tires, fenders, and the frame near the front wheel. Do not remove a safety accessory merely to force a bike into an unsuitable rack.
Give each rider a rack they can use
A storage system fails when one person cannot load it. Ask each rider to lift the bike into the proposed orientation. Use a wall mark or an empty hook mockup rather than holding a bicycle overhead near a car. If the motion is awkward when rested and the bike is clean, it will be worse after a wet ride.
Children’s bikes usually belong low or on the floor. A heavy electric bike may fit a wall rack’s published capacity yet remain a poor daily choice because lifting it risks the rider, wall, or bike. Put the most frequently used bikes closest to the exit and leave enough room to roll them out without moving two others.
Use vertical racks when wall width is scarce
Vertical storage turns a bike’s length into wall projection. Several bikes can occupy a shorter wall if the handlebars overlap. Feedback Sports recommends roughly 16 to 24 inches between Velo Hinge hooks depending on stud spacing and staggered heights. Its current Velo Hinge 2.0 FAQ explains a practical mockup: lay bikes near each other to see how handlebars nest, then transfer the height difference to the wall.
That spacing is product guidance, not a universal rule. Wide mountain-bike bars, baskets, and brake levers demand more. Mark the full wheel and handlebar envelope, then protect the adjacent car door and the person loading the bike.

Pivoting racks can recover the aisle after loading
A pivoting rack holds the bike vertically, then swings it toward the wall. This can reduce how far the row occupies the aisle when stored. Feedback Sports lists the Velo Hinge 2.0 for up to 50 pounds when properly mounted to a wall stud, with a 4-inch hook opening and published compatibility from 700C by 23 mm through 29 by 3.0 inch combinations. See the manufacturer page for the exact fit diagram and instructions.
Include the pivot sweep in the layout. Pedals and handlebars move sideways as the bike folds. A neighboring cabinet, car mirror, or second bike can stop the hinge before it reaches the useful angle.
Horizontal cradles favor easy access and a long wall
Horizontal racks support the frame on padded arms. The bike stays closer to normal carrying height and becomes easy to inspect before a ride. This format works nicely above a low cabinet or along a wall with no door, although the full wheelbase and handlebars occupy considerable width.
Feedback Sports lists its Velo Wall Rack 2D at a 50-pound maximum, with cradle projection adjustable from 8 to 12 inches and vertical arm adjustment. The official product page warns that very wide handlebars, long wheelbases, and fat bikes may not suit it. Frame contact matters. Confirm that both cradles support strong tube locations without pressing cables or delicate finishes.

Simple hooks still require a structural decision
A vinyl-coated hook can be a sensible low-cost answer for a standard bike. Park Tool lists its 451 wood-thread hook at a 115-pound hook limit when securely screwed into solid material, while making the user responsible for the mounting material. Read the manufacturer page closely. The large hook rating does not turn thin drywall into structure.
Confirm tire and rim fit, thread engagement, and the direction of loading. Use the fastener and substrate called for by the manufacturer. If you do not know what is inside the wall, find out before drilling or choose a supported floor rack.
Keep bicycles outside the parking and door envelopes
A vertically stored bike projects about its length from the wall until it pivots. A horizontal bike projects by its handlebar and pedal width while stretching along the wall. Tape both shapes on the floor and wall. Open the vehicle doors, house door, garage door, cabinets, and freezer. Then walk the normal path with grocery bags or a trash bin.
Compare the remaining route with the garage workshop aisle clearance guide. A handlebar end at face height deserves extra space. Place a rear-wheel bumper or wall protector where the system expects one, and keep oily chains away from clothing paths and painted car panels.
Store electric bikes for weight, heat, and cables
The motor does not harm a rack, but the added weight changes lifting and mounting. Use the complete bike weight with battery and accessories when comparing rack capacity. Follow the bicycle and battery manufacturers’ storage and charging instructions. Do not assume removing the battery is optional or required; platform guidance varies.
A floor rack is often the honest solution. It lets a rider roll the bike into place and keeps a heavy frame low. Give the kickstand, pedals, and handlebars room, and keep charging cords out of tire and walking paths. Check whether a front-wheel stand clears the brake rotor and fender, and whether the tire stays stable at normal pressure. A plain arrangement that works after a tiring ride will beat an overhead system that everyone avoids.

Be cautious with ceiling storage
Ceiling hoists and overhead cradles free wall and floor space, but they add lifting, rope management, and a falling-object concern. They also compete with the open garage door, tracks, opener, lights, and overhead racks. Use them only for bicycles light enough to handle safely and ridden rarely enough that the access penalty is acceptable.
Verify the structure, fasteners, hardware capacity, locking method, and clear operating route from the exact manual. Never hang a bicycle where a partial release could reach a person or vehicle. If the ceiling location requires standing on another ladder while controlling the bike, choose a different storage method.
Mock up the row before drilling
Cut cardboard rectangles for the rack bodies and tape outlines for wheels, bars, and pedals. Mark stud locations. Bring every bicycle into position one at a time and rehearse the loading motion. Stagger heights only as much as each rider can manage.
Leave the mockup for several days. If it blocks the route or requires moving another bike, revise it. Check the garage wall storage options for renters when permanent anchors are not permitted. A freestanding rack may consume more floor area, but it avoids unsafe guesses about an unfamiliar wall. If bikes must share the same surface with tools, compare the hardware and working heights in the garage wall storage systems guide before committing the studs.
Write each rider’s name on the temporary position and try a normal weekday reset. Helmets, locks, pumps, and child seats need homes too. Watch which bike gets left in the aisle when someone returns tired or in a hurry. That abandoned bike usually exposes a hook set too high, a blocked loading lane, or an accessory that catches the neighboring handlebars. Fix the awkward step before drilling.

Frequently asked questions
Is it safe to hang a bike by one wheel?
Use a rack designed for wheel storage and confirm the wheel, tire, bike weight, mounting surface, and hardware meet the manufacturer’s requirements. Do not force a fat tire, deep rim, fender, or incompatible wheel into a basic hook. Inspect the rack and contact point regularly.
How far apart should vertical bike racks be?
Spacing depends on handlebar width, bike size, stud locations, and whether heights are staggered. Feedback Sports suggests roughly 16 to 24 inches for its Velo Hinge setup as a starting point. Mock up the actual bikes and follow the exact rack instructions.
What is the easiest storage for a heavy electric bike?
A compatible floor stand is usually easiest because the bike can roll into place. A wall rack may carry the published weight but still require an uncomfortable lift. Consider the shortest and least strong regular rider, battery guidance, tire fit, and charging-cord route.
Can a bike rack mount only to drywall?
Use only the substrate and fasteners specified by the rack manufacturer. Many wall racks require a wood stud, masonry, or another solid support. Drywall by itself is not a safe default. If the wall structure is uncertain, choose a freestanding system or get qualified installation help.
